Audio output frequency is that range of frequencies that can be heard. For humans, that is generally considered to be the range of 20Hz to 20kHz.

What are the frequency components at the output of the modulator?

The frequency components at the output of a modulator typically include the carrier frequency and the sidebands generated by the modulation process. For amplitude modulation (AM), the output contains the carrier frequency along with upper and lower sidebands, which are spaced from the carrier by the modulating frequency. In frequency modulation (FM), the output consists of the carrier frequency and a series of sidebands determined by Bessel functions, reflecting the modulation index. The specific frequencies present depend on the modulation scheme and the characteristics of the input signal.

What is the definition of audio-frequency transformer?

An audio frequency transformer is a transformer designed to operate in the range of frequencies audible to the average human. This range is generally accepted to be from 20 Hz to 20,000 Hz. The usual purpose of an audio transformer is to match impedances between circuit sections. For example: between a microphone and the input of an amplifier, (input transformer), or between the output of an amplifier and the loud speaker. (output transformer).

What is the output frequency of mod-45 counter if the input frequency is 9 khz and how?

A mod-45 counter divides the input frequency by 45. If the input frequency is 9 kHz, the output frequency can be calculated by dividing 9 kHz by 45. Therefore, the output frequency is 9,000 Hz / 45 = 200 Hz. Thus, the output frequency of the mod-45 counter is 200 Hz.


What is the scientific meaning of the phrase 'frequency response'?

Frequency response refers to how a system or device reacts to different frequencies of an input signal. It describes the relationship between the input frequency and the output amplitude or phase of a system, such as an electronic circuit or an audio device. A frequency response plot shows how the system attenuates or amplifies different frequencies.
